首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ql 查看存储路径

MySQL 查看存储路径

基础概念

MySQL 是一个关系型数据库管理系统,它将数据存储在文件系统中。每个数据库在文件系统中都有一个或多个目录,用于存储表、索引和其他数据库对象的数据文件。

相关优势

  • 可靠性:MySQL 提供了多种存储引擎,如 InnoDB,支持事务处理和行级锁定,确保数据的完整性和一致性。
  • 性能:MySQL 优化了 I/O 操作和内存使用,能够处理大量数据和高并发访问。
  • 灵活性:支持多种存储引擎,可以根据应用需求选择合适的存储方式。

类型

MySQL 的存储路径主要涉及以下几个方面:

  1. 数据目录:存储数据库文件和日志文件。
  2. 临时目录:存储临时表和临时文件。
  3. 二进制日志目录:存储二进制日志文件,用于数据恢复和主从复制。

应用场景

在以下场景中,查看 MySQL 的存储路径是非常重要的:

  • 数据库备份和恢复
  • 性能调优
  • 故障排查

如何查看存储路径

可以通过以下几种方法查看 MySQL 的存储路径:

  1. 通过配置文件: 打开 MySQL 的配置文件(通常是 my.cnfmy.ini),查找 datadir 参数,该参数指定了数据目录的路径。
  2. 通过配置文件: 打开 MySQL 的配置文件(通常是 my.cnfmy.ini),查找 datadir 参数,该参数指定了数据目录的路径。
  3. 通过命令行: 登录到 MySQL 服务器,执行以下 SQL 命令:
  4. 通过命令行: 登录到 MySQL 服务器,执行以下 SQL 命令:
  5. 这将返回数据目录的路径。
  6. 通过系统命令: 在 Linux 系统中,可以使用以下命令查看 MySQL 的数据目录:
  7. 通过系统命令: 在 Linux 系统中,可以使用以下命令查看 MySQL 的数据目录:
  8. 这将显示 MySQL 配置文件的路径,然后可以打开该文件查找 datadir 参数。

遇到的问题及解决方法

如果在查看存储路径时遇到问题,可能是以下原因:

  1. 权限问题
    • 确保你有足够的权限访问 MySQL 的配置文件和数据目录。
    • 使用 sudo 命令提升权限。
  • 配置文件路径错误
    • 确保你知道 MySQL 配置文件的正确路径。
    • 如果不确定,可以使用 find 命令查找:
    • 如果不确定,可以使用 find 命令查找:
  • MySQL 服务未启动
    • 确保 MySQL 服务已经启动。
    • 使用以下命令启动 MySQL 服务:
    • 使用以下命令启动 MySQL 服务:

通过以上方法,你应该能够成功查看 MySQL 的存储路径,并解决相关问题。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券